About The Position

The Department of Statistics at Colorado State University currently comprises 19 faculty and over 50 graduate students, and has a network of faculty affiliates at nearby research agencies. Our faculty members have a wide range of expertise and are involved in various interdisciplinary graduate training and research activities. The Department seeks applicants from individuals who are interested in obtaining postdoctoral research experience in the area of statistics and related areas. Individuals in those positions are expected to conduct a program of research in collaboration with one or more faculty members in the Department of Statistics and to teach a limited number of courses. A teaching load of one to two courses per semester is expected. The open positions are temporary. Annual terms and reappointment may depend on performance and/or the continued availability of funding.
